## ProfileVault Environments

ProfileVault shards the user-profile store across four partitions in staging and sixteen in production. Shard assignment is hash-based on account ID, so rebalancing only happens during planned resharding windows. If you're on call and see hot-shard alerts, check the partition map before touching anything — most pages resolve to a single overloaded shard. The active shard configuration for production is as follows.

settings of hahag-taweg:
[jorius]
team = gilox
access_code = ac_b64218
host = jorius.zarqelstack.example
port = 8080
owner = quenath.briax
peer = eliix.halixcloud.corp

This PR reworks the Tallbridge fleet fuel-usage report to aggregate per-depot rather than per-vehicle, fixing the double-counting seen in the Ashgrove rollout. All figures were cross-checked against last quarter's manual audit. Please review the smoothing and outlier thresholds carefully, as they directly affect the published numbers.

constants for fawep-yagap:
QUOTAS = {
    "noveth": 275,
    "oliion": 740,
}

Changed defaults in Splitfork, our assignment service. Bucketing now uses sticky hashing per account instead of per session, and the holdout slice grew from 2% to 5%. Callers relying on session-level reassignment must opt in explicitly. Review the diff against the new baseline; the updated default configuration is listed below.

config for tagep-kajof:
[casir]
port = 6379
region = south-1
host = casir.paliqdyn.example
team = tamax
timeout_ms = 250
retries = 2

Handover Note — Marla Venn to Dorek Hale

As agreed, the Calverton Street office will close at the end of next quarter. Remaining staff transfer to the Bridlemere hub; sales leads should route territory queries to Dorek from Monday. Lease termination is with legal, and client-facing messaging is being drafted. Nothing changes for pipeline targets this cycle. The confidential note below covers the wider plan.

internal memo for kaguf-yajog: Headcount on the Druath team goes from 30 to 70 by the end of November. Gross margin on Druath came in at 56 percent against a plan of 28 percent.